Cliff Booth, played by Brad Pitt in Quentin Tarantino’s Once Upon a Time in Hollywood, is a mysterious stuntman and war veteran. He’s loyal to fading TV star Rick Dalton, acting as his driver, handyman, and sometimes even his confidant. Rumors swirl around Cliff, particularly about his possibly killing his wife. While never confirmed, it adds to his enigmatic aura. He’s skilled in hand-to-hand combat, demonstrated by his impressive brawl with Bruce Lee on the set of The Green Hornet. Despite his tough exterior, Cliff shows a softer side through his friendship with his dog, Brandy. His ambiguous past and capability for violence make him a compelling and complex character.
